  4. Smoothie Strapless Moulded Bra (CK008109)

    1
    like

    32DD

    Hasn't set fit

    I bought this as a gift for someone else, who isn't a bra enthusiast but just wanted something practical and versatile. This ticks the boxes for them, and feels super well made. The outer fabric is beyond smooth, with an inner sling in the cup to aid shaping and support. There's a silicone grip along the top and bottom of the underhand, along with fully adjustable, detachable shoulder straps (using swan hooks) so it can be work strapless, traditional over-the-shoulder, cross-back, halter, or even one-shoulder. The wings are bagged out with the same silky, smooth microfibre over a firm powermesh.

  5. Princess Balcony Bra (CK6001)

    1
    like

    32DD

    Didn't fit

    This is an unlined, lace/mesh, underwire bra. I usually look awful in a balconette (with my horizontal oval shape), but the seaming on this one makes it ok. However, the wing height was too short (too much underarm spillage).

    About me: petite with wide horizontal oval, slightly conical breasts
    * average projection
    * wide-set (3 fingers width of space between breasts)
    * very wide roots (extend past the mid-axillary line)
    * short roots
    * even horizontal fullness (just barely outer full)
    * mix of firm & soft tissue (front molds to shape of bra, sides push wimpy wires away)
    * conical shape (but will squish to round)
    * full on top (2/4 shape, not even or very full) - BUT functionally even to FOB due to short roots and soft tissue
    * petite (5'3") so have narrow frame

    • Agree that this bra just looks too small for you. And you may find that the curvy Kate bra bands are really loose, stretchy, and physically longer than other bra brands. I agree with going for the 32E. But how does the band feel? Can you easily stretch it several inches away from your body? Does it move around when stretching your arms upwards and moving around? You may find a 30F may be ideal for you with curvy Kate. The bra looks like it's going to be a great fit when you jail down the size.

      I bring up going down to a 30 band in curvy Kate because it looks like you have some vertical stretching in the cups and straps going on which can either mean that you have the straps tightened too tight or the straps are supporting more of your bust than they should be because the band is too loose. I get these vertical stretches in my 30 band bras all the time because 30 bands are too big for me, I need a 28 band. Just remember if you do go down in band size you have to go up in cup size to keep the same cup volume.
